Professor Green has confirmed he's not working with 'Origababes'

  • January 11, 2012
  • Brad O'Mance

Professor Green has denied rumours that he's working with Siobhan, Mutya and Keisha, aka 'Origibabes'.

Speaking to The Music, the rapper laughed off spec­u­la­tion of a col­lab­or­a­tion, saying: "People got the wrong end of the stick. I was in the same studio then that I'm in now."

This was in response to Keisha's initial tweet, which went exactly like this: "Hanging out in the studio with @professorgreen and two lovely ladies with bags of talent :-p lol."

This is basically con­firm­a­tion of our original feature where we said the tweet was a red herring, but everyone's getting a bit 'see, it's def­in­itely not happening' about it all.
